Screening For Hypertriglyceridemia Every Five Years Is Recommended

Adults should be screened for hypertriglyceridemia every five years, according to a Clinical Practice Guideline (CPG) for the diagnosis and treatment of the condition, which has been issued today by the Endocrine Society in theJournal of Clinical Endocrinology and Metabolism (JCEM)... via Featured Health News from Medical News Today Read More Here..
